Things to consider when buy jacket:
- Cordura material: Thick fabric that holds shape. Do not flap during high speed like those light nylon material. Should be rain-proof.
- Leather: More expensive. Depends on leather thickness. Need more care because we are in tropical country by wearing it more often and oiling it.
- Nylon.
- Mesh - Most airy, like net. No protection against rain. biggrin.gif
*
cordura is not rain-proof bro..the inner plastic liner is..
